Output 8062ecbfae08657e5721f83f1ac66116c14348cc66ebb2296bb23a52b2d21cd4:29

value
7728325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c184ffe584a0cff3ffcd7f827134c4969a7c64 OP_EQUAL
address
3MuZ5unbSiahwQTUDXo5X55kyayAaoKhQj
transaction
8062ecbfae08657e5721f83f1ac66116c14348cc66ebb2296bb23a52b2d21cd4
spent
true